What each tier adds

The set difference between each tier's feature list and the one beneath it. Where a tier lists nothing new, the vendor has either stopped repeating the inherited list or the tier raises limits rather than adding capability, the record does not distinguish the two, so this page does not either.

Beginner

Free

The entry tier. It covers 5 personal projects, smart quick add, task reminders, flexible layouts, 3 filter views, 1 week activity history.

Pro

$5/month

Over Beginner, this tier adds:

  • 300 personal projects
  • Calendar layout
  • Custom task reminders
  • 150 filter views
  • Full reporting history
  • Task Assist AI
  • Unlimited Ramble

Business

$8/month

Over Pro, this tier adds:

  • Everything in Pro
  • Shared team workspace
  • Up to 500 team projects
  • Team roles and permissions
  • Centralized team billing
  • SOC2 Type II compliant

Before you pay for Todoist

Three things this page cannot tell you, and all three change the bill. The record carries a price and a billing period but not the unit - per-seat and flat-rate pricing are indistinguishable in this data, so a five-person team may be looking at five times the figure above. It carries no annual rate, so any discount for paying yearly is not something this page can quote. And it carries no trial length.

What it can tell you is the shape of the ladder: 3 tiers between Free and $8/month, with the jump itemised above. Because there is a free tier, the cheapest way to answer the rest is to use it before paying anything.
